What NIPT Means in Modern Prenatal Care

Non-Invasive Prenatal Testing works by analysing small fragments of fetal DNA that circulate naturally in the mother’s bloodstream during pregnancy. This DNA originates from the placenta and reflects the baby’s chromosomal makeup. By studying these fragments, we can assess the risk for common chromosomal conditions with a very high level of accuracy.

In my practice, I emphasise that NIPT is a screening test, not a diagnosis. It helps us stratify risk early in pregnancy, allowing us to either provide reassurance or guide families toward further evaluation when required. When used responsibly, NIPT significantly reduces unnecessary invasive procedures and the anxiety associated with them.

When I Advise NIPT During Pregnancy

NIPT can be performed safely from 10 weeks of gestation onwards, once there is sufficient fetal DNA in the maternal blood. Performing the test at the correct time is essential to ensure reliable results and reduce test failure rates.

At MOM Fetal Scans, I rarely recommend NIPT in isolation. It is best integrated with a first-trimester ultrasound and NT scan, allowing us to assess both genetic risk and early fetal development together. This combined approach gives a clearer clinical picture and avoids misinterpretation of results.

Who Should Consider NIPT Screening

While NIPT can be offered to all pregnant women, it is especially valuable in pregnancies where the genetic risk may be higher. This includes advanced maternal age pregnancies, those with abnormal screening markers, or a previous history of chromosomal conditions.

What Conditions NIPT Can Screen For

NIPT primarily screens for the most common chromosomal abnormalities that can significantly affect fetal development and long-term outcomes. These include Down syndrome (Trisomy 21), Trisomy 18, and Trisomy 13. Some testing panels may also assess select sex chromosome conditions.

I always explain to parents that NIPT does not replace detailed ultrasound scans. Structural anomalies, organ development issues, and many genetic syndromes can only be detected through high-resolution ultrasound and targeted diagnostic testing.

Understanding Accuracy and Limitations

NIPT has a very high detection rate for common trisomies, making it one of the most reliable screening tools available today. However, it remains a risk assessment tool, not a confirmatory diagnosis.

In my consultations, I focus heavily on result interpretation. A “high-risk” report does not mean the baby is affected—it means further diagnostic testing may be needed. Similarly, a “low-risk” result is reassuring but does not rule out all genetic or structural conditions.

NIPT vs Invasive Prenatal Testing

Invasive tests such as chorionic villus sampling (CVS) and amniocentesis provide definitive diagnosis but carry a small procedure-related risk. NIPT helps us identify which pregnancies truly require these diagnostic procedures.

No screening test is 100% accurate. While NIPT has very high sensitivity and specificity for common chromosomal conditions, it remains a screening test, not a diagnostic test. Any high-risk result must be confirmed through invasive diagnostic testing.

Rarely, discrepancies may occur due to biological factors such as placental mosaicism or low fetal DNA fraction. This is why NIPT results should always be interpreted by a fetal medicine specialist and correlated with ultrasound findings.

Yes. A low-risk NIPT result does not replace routine pregnancy ultrasounds. Anomaly scans, growth scans, and Doppler studies remain essential to assess fetal structure, development, and wellbeing throughout pregnancy.
